The main difference between the latches and flip flops is that, a latch checks input continuously and changes the output whenever there is a change in input. What is the difference between a flip flop and a latch. Digital integrated circuits such as memory chips and micro processors are logical circuits. Latches are asynchronous, which means that the output changes very soon after the input changes.
In contrast, the flipflop is a combination of a clock and a latch, and its output is changed according to the clock when there is a change in the input. Electronicsflip flops wikibooks, open books for an open. Flip flop is a basic digital memory circuit, which stores one bit of information. Both flip flops and latches are elements of sequential circuitry in electronics.
But first, lets clarify the difference between a latch and a flip flop. This fact will make it somewhat easier to understand latches and flip flops. Have you wondered what are flip flops and where they are used. Clock signal and triggering methods, difference between latch and flip flop sequential circuits duration. We will also discuss positive and negative edge triggering trigger which clocks the way in which the input state changes in sequential circuits. It is also known as a bistable multivibrator or a binary or onebit memory. A flip flop is a device very like a latch in that it is a bistable multivibrator, having two states and a feedback path that allows it to store a bit of information.
Then, it introduces clocks and shows how they can be used to synchronize latches to get gated latches. Flip flops are used as memory elements in sequential circuit. Latches a temporary storage device that has two stable states bistable the sr setreset latch also called a multivibrator when q is high, q is low, and when q is low, q is high truth table for an activelow input sr latch. Both latches and flip flops are circuit elements wherein the output not only depends on the current inputs, but also depends on the previous input and outputs.
But here is the d flip flop schematic i found in various tutorials. What is the difference between a d latch and a d f. The main difference between them lies in the fact that a latch does not have a clock signal, whereas a flip flop always does. Both latches and flip flops are circuit elements whose output depends not only on the current inputs, but also on previous inputs and outputs. The first flipflop circuit was known differently as multivibrators or trigger circuits. What is the basic difference between latch and a flipflop. As flipflops are bistable devices, these sequential circuits are sometimes called latches because their outputs are locked or latched onto their input state until. Conversion of flipflops from one flipflop to another. The difference between flip flops and latches is the way in which the logic changes the state of their outputs. A latch can be said as the another name of flip flop as the only difference between a latch and the flip flop is that a latch is an level triggered device where as flip flop is an edge triggered. Flip flops are synchronous bistable devices, while latches consider as asynchronous bistabile devices. Latches are something in your design which always needs attention. The main difference between latches and flipflops is that for latches, their outputs are constantly.
Flip flop flip flops are also the building blocks of sequential circuits. Partovi, isscc96 vdd d clk q q d1 d0 signal at node x second stage latch pulse generator d1 d0. Gated s r latches or clocked s r flip flops electrical4u. Level sensitive crosscoupled nor gates active high inputs only one can be active. The difference between a latch and a flipflop is that a latch is leveltriggered outputs can change as soon as the inputs changes and flipflop is edge triggered only changes state when a control signal goes from high to low or low to high. Flip flops are the fundamental blocks of most sequential circuits. D data or delay, t toggle, sr setreset and jk jackkilby.
Also know about the indepth procedure of triggering of flip flops. The difference between latches and flip flops include the following. A flip flop is a device which stores a single bit binary digit of data. Chapter 9 latches, flipflops, and timers shawnee state university.
Most d flops also have the s and r inputs of a sr flip flop. Several latches can be combined in parallel to form a register. It is the basic storage element in sequential logic. The main difference between the latch and flip flop is that a flip flop has a clock signal, whereas a latch does not. What is the difference between a flipflop and a latch. What is the difference between latch and flip flop. One latch or flipflop can store one bit of information. D flips have a clock input, and when this clock rises or falls, depending on the type, the d input is clocked into the flip flop. Latches and flipflops latches and flipflops are circuits with memory function. Both latches and flipflops are circuit elements whose output depends not. Latches are sometimes called transparent latches, because they are transparent input directly connected to. The main difference between a latch and a flipflop is that for a latch, its state or output is constantly affected by its input as long as its enable signal is asserted. In electronics, a latch, is a kind of bistable multi vibrator, an electronic circuit which. There are basically four main types of latches and flip flops.
A flop flop s clock input will often be drawn with a triangle, denoting it as an edge sensitive input. A latch is a circuit element that alters the output based on the current input, previous input, and previous output. The effect of the clock is to define discrete time intervals. The clock signal is used so that the latch inputs are ignored except when the clock signal is asserted. Digital flip flops are memory devices used for storing binary data in sequential logic circuits. Latch and flip flops are basic building blocks of sequential logic circuits, hence the memory. I heard that the main difference between latch and flip flops is that latches are asynchronous while flip flops are edge triggered which makes sense. Construction of sr flip flop there are following two methods for constructing a sr flip flop by using nor latch. The difference between a latch and a flip flop is that a latch does not have a clock signal, whereas a flip flop always does. Latches latches are the building blocks of sequential circuits. A flip flop always has a clock signal both are same but there is a little difference between both. In rs flipflop, reset input has high priority and in sr flipflop, set input has high priority.
Difference between latch and flip flop electronics for you. The difference between a latch and a flop flop is when the data inputs are sampled. The differences here are that a tff will toggle its output every time it recieves a signal, and a dff will change its output based on what is on the data line when it is. But unlike latches, flip flops will change the content at the active edge of clock signal only.
The difference between a latch and a flip flop is that a latch is asynchronous, and the outputs can change as soon as the inputs do or at least after a small propagation delay. The flip flops are built from latches and it includes an additional clock signal apart from the inputs used in the latches. In electronics, a flip flop or latch is a circuit that has two stable states and can be used to store state information a bistable multivibrator. When both the inputs are asserted simultaneously, like their latch i. Difference between a flipflop and a latch is in the method used for changing their state. This bit of information that is stored in a latch or flip flop is referred to as the state of the latch or flip flop. In digital technology there is a distinction between simple latches and clocked flip flops.
Since this latch responds to the applied inputs only when the level of the clock pulse is high, this type of flip flop is also called level triggered flip flop. A flip flop is a device very like a latch in that it is a bistable mutivibrator, having two states and a feedback path that allows it to store a bit of information. In other words, when they are enabled, their content changes immediately when their inputs change. The major difference between latches and flipflops is that a latch doesnt contain any clock signal whereas flipflops consist of a clock signal. Difference between a latch and a flip flop both latches and flip flops are circuit elements whose output depends not only on the present inputs, but also on previous inputs and outputs. Digital flip flop circuits explained learn about flip. But, flip flop is a combination of latch and clock that continuously checks input and changes the. Difference between flip flop and latch flip flop vs latch. Here is the design of a dlatch from one book which i can understand. The limitation of the simple latch is that one can not enter a new value to the input while reading the output. How can we make a circuit out of gates that is not. What is the basic difference between latches and flip flops. Jk flip flop difference between latches and flip flops. A sequential logic circuit is a type of digital circuit which responds not only to the present inputs, but to the present state or past of the circuit.
Difference between latch and flipflop difference between. A flip flop, on the other hand, is edgetriggered and only changes state when a control signal goes from high to low or low to high. In this article, we will discuss about sr flip flop. Latches are level sensitive and flip flops are edge sensitive. It means that the latch s output change with a change in input levels and the flip flop s output only change when there is an edge of controlling signal. Read here to know the basic difference between a latch and a flipflop. Flip flops and latches are fundamental building blocks of digital electronics systems used in computers, communications, and many other types of systems. The main difference between latches and flipflops is that for latches, their outputs are constantly affected by their inputs as long as the enable signal is asserted. One of the most frequent but confusing question that we face during viva and interviews is the difference between a latch and a flip flop. What is the difference between a t and a d flip flop. So, gated sr latch is also called clocked sr flip flop or synchronous sr latch. Generally, latches and flips are classified into different types such as dtype data delay, srtype setreset, ttype toggle and jktype.
Ff is a circuit element where the op not only depends on the present inputs but also depends on the former input and ops. Output changes whenever clockenable is high or low a common implementation of a flip flop is a pair of latches masterslave flop. Latches and flip flops 1 the sr latch this is the first in a series of videos about latches and flip flops. A single latch or flip flop can store only one bit of information. The circuit can be made to change state by signals applied to one or more control inputs and will have one or two outputs. Assume that initially the set and clear inputs and the q output are all lo. In contrast, the flip flop is a combination of a clock and a latch, and its output is changed according to the clock when there is a change in the input. Also, there are at least 4 different types of flip flops that differ in the way you set and read back state. Flip flops and latches are used as data storage elements. They both accomplish the same purpose with different circuits. Differences between latches and flip flops with comparison. What is the difference between registers, flip flops and. The main difference between latch and flip flop is that the latch checks the input continuously and changes the output when there is a change in the input. Difference between d latch schematic and d flip flop schematic.
What is the difference between a register and a flipflop. One latch or flip flop can store one bit of information. They both are hence referred as sequential elements. Id expect a register to be more than 1 bit say, 64 or 32 or maybe 16 or 8 bits, and a flip flop to be only 1 bit. The logical circuit of a gated sr latch or clocked sr flip flop. A latch is always sampling its data inputs, while a flop flop only samples its data inputs on a clock edge. Latches and sequential logic circuits this video discusses the differences between sequential and combinational logic circuits as well as sr. What is the difference between a latch and a flipflop. Latches and flip flops are the basic elements and these are used to store information. Hence, they are the fundamental building blocks for all sequential circuits. Sr flip flop sr flip flop is the simplest type of flip flops. Latches and flip flops are the basic elements for storing information. But when i check out their shematic they seem pretty much same.